Q: Is 1,756,605 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,756,605 is a composite number.

Why is 1,756,605 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,756,605 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 181 543 647 905 1,941 2,715 3,235 9,705 117,107 351,321 585,535 and 1,756,605, with no remainder.

Since 1,756,605 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,756,605, it is a composite number.
